logo

Location of Lancaster Hall Hotel

Location

35 Craven Terrace, London, United Kingdom
Situated just moments from the expansive greenery of Kensington Gardens and Hyde Park, this hotel offers an ideal location for those looking to explore central London. Known for their beautiful landscapes and numerous attractions, these parks are home to iconic sites such as Kensington Palace, the Albert Memorial, and the Diana Memorial Fountain. Notably, the Lancaster Hall Hotel is conveniently positioned approximately 500 meters from Paddington Station, an essential transport hub providing quick access to numerous destinations and the Heathrow Express. Other attractions, including the Natural History Museum and the bustling streets of Notting Hill, are also within easy reach, making it a perfect base for both business and leisure travelers.
Check rooms and rates
From92US$ /night
Check-in
12Dec2024Select date
Check-out
13Dec2024Select date
Rooms and Guests2 Guests, 1 Room
Map view
street view
35 Craven Terrace, London, United Kingdom
Nearby
Praed St
Paddington
460 m
LondonEngland
Bayswater
130 m
Monument
Peter Pan Statue
540 m
Restaurants
Craven Cafe
40 m
15 Craven Terrace Paddington
Raffles Cafe Restaurant
280 m
13 Craven Road Paddington
Cafe Dylan Dog
310 m
7 Craven Road
Caffe Nero
380 m
14-15 Spring Street
Bathurst Deli
720 m
3 Bathurst Street No .3
Mimos Cafe Bar
570 m
19 London Street Paddington
Sandro Sandwich Bar
480 m
22 Spring Street
Warisan Cafe
490 m
190 Sussex Gardens Paddington
The Italian Gardens Cafe
380 m
Kensington Gardens Lancaster Gate entrance
Pat's Cafe
390 m
19 Leinster Terrace
Contact us
We’re at your service